I am trying to create diskless clients that run off a ramdisk and not
an NFS share.  I have a need to disconnect the network boot server
from the clients.  I have the resources to have a 1GB ram disk running
in memory on the client machines.  The problem I have is that during
the network booting of the clients the machine hangs at the following
message:

RAMDISK: Compressed image found at block 0

What am I doing wrong?
I had originally received an RAMDISK: incomplete write error (-28 !=
65535) after the previous error. I fixed it but increasing the
ramdisk_size value in the kernel and recompiled it.
Now it just hangs.   I am not sure how to trouble shoot this.  Have
been goggling this with no success.
